Nano-aperture array based optical imaging system on a microfluidic chip
We report the implementation of a novel nano-aperture array based imaging technique in a microfluidic network, termed ldquooptofluidic microscopy (OFM)rdquo. The OFM prototype features high resolution, compact volume and capable of high-throughput sample imaging.
